The STMicroelectronics NUCLEO-64 boards offer an accessible and adaptable platform for developing and prototyping with STM32 microcontrollers. The NUCLEO-F446RE board features the STM32F446RET6 microcontroller, providing a balance of performance, power efficiency, and diverse functionalities. It supports Arduino Uno V3 connectivity and includes ST morpho headers for expanding its capabilities with various specialized shields.

This board integrates an ST-LINK/V2-1 debugger and programmer, eliminating the need for separate debugging tools. It comes with the comprehensive STM32 software HAL library, numerous software examples, and access to Arm Mbed online resources.

Các tính năng chính:

  • STM32F446RET6 microcontroller in LQFP64 package.
  • High-performance ARM Cortex-M4 core with DSP and FPU, 512 Kbytes Flash, 180 MHz CPU.
  • On-board ST-LINK/V2-1 debugger/programmer with SWD connector and USB re-enumeration (mass storage, Virtual COM port, debug port).
  • Arduino Uno V3 connectivity support and ST morpho extension pin headers.
  • Flexible power-supply options: ST-LINK USB VBUS or external sources.
  • One user LED shared with Arduino, two additional LEDs, and two push-buttons (user and reset).
  • 32.768 kHz LSE crystal oscillator.

2. Thiết lập và cấu hình ban đầu

Follow these steps to set up your NUCLEO-F446RE development board for the first time.

2.1. Bắt đầu

  1. Kiểm tra vị trí nhảy dây: Ensure jumpers JP1 (off), JP5 (PWR) on U5V side, and JP6 (IDD) are correctly set on the board.
  2. Kết nối với PC: Connect the STM32 Nucleo board to a PC using a USB Type-A to Mini-B cable through connector CN1.
  3. Power-Up Indication: Upon successful connection, the red LEDs LD3 (PWR) and LD1 (COM) should light up, and the green LED LD2 will blink.
  4. User Button Test: Press the user button B1 (left button) and observe the blinking pattern of the green LED LD2. It should change according to the button press.
  5. Phần mềm trình diễn: The board comes with pre-loaded demo software. Explore its features to understand basic functionalities.
  6. Develop Applications: Begin developing your own applications using available examples and libraries.

The NUCLEO-F446RE board is designed for flexible operation, supporting various programming and debugging methods.

3.1. Lập trình và gỡ lỗi

The integrated ST-LINK/V2-1 debugger/programmer allows for easy code upload and debugging. When connected via USB, the ST-LINK/V2-1 enumerates as three different interfaces:

  • Thiết bị lưu trữ dung lượng lớn: For drag-and-drop programming of binary files.
  • Cổng COM ảo: For serial communication with the host PC.
  • Cổng gỡ lỗi: For debugging applications using compatible IDEs.

3.2. Expanding Functionality

The board's functionality can be extended using its expansion connectors:

  • Arduino Uno V3 Connectivity: Allows attachment of Arduino-compatible shields.
  • ST Morpho Extension Headers: Provides full access to all STM32 I/Os for custom connections and shield development.

If you encounter issues with your NUCLEO-F446RE board, consider the following troubleshooting steps:

  • No Power Indication (LEDs Off):
    • Ensure the USB cable is securely connected to both the board (CN1) and the PC.
    • Hãy thử cổng USB hoặc cáp khác.
    • Verify that the PC's USB port is providing power.
    • Check jumper settings, especially JP5 (PWR).
  • ST-LINK/V2-1 Not Recognized by PC:
    • Install the necessary ST-LINK drivers. These are usually part of the STM32CubeIDE or available on the STMicroelectronics webđịa điểm.
    • Hãy thử khởi động lại máy tính của bạn.
    • Ensure the USB cable is functioning correctly.
  • Application Not Running/Debugging Issues:
    • Verify your development environment (IDE) is correctly configured for the STM32F446RET6 microcontroller.
    • Check your code for errors and ensure it's compiled correctly.
    • Ensure the debugger is connected and configured properly in your IDE.
    • Reset the board using the reset button.
  • Các vấn đề ngoại vi:
    • Double-check all wiring and connections to external components or shields.
    • Verify that the correct pins are being used and initialized in your software.
    • Consult the STM32F446RET6 datasheet and reference manual for peripheral configuration details.
